Redhat AS 4 双网卡绑定

刚在一台IBM Xserver服务器上装了RedHat Linux Enterprise AS 4,为了提高网络的可靠性配置双网卡绑定。

一、环境描述

我的RedHat Linux Enterprise AS 4安装双口的Intel千兆网卡,通过ifconfig -a命令看到eth0和eth1两张网卡。

二、双网卡绑定步骤:

2.1 修改/etc/sysconfig/network-scripts/ifcfg-eth0配置文件,修改后的内容如下:

DEVICE=eth0

ONBOOT=yes                #系统启动时自动启用该设备

BOOTPROTO=none      #启动时不使用任何协议

MASTER=bond0    ###############################

SLAVE=yes ###############

2.2 修改/etc/sysconfig/network-scripts/ifcfg-eth1配置文件,修改后的内容如下:

DEVICE=eth1

ONBOOT=yes                #系统启动时自动启用该设备

BOOTPROTO=none      #启动时不使用任何协议

MASTER=bond0

SLAVE=yes

2.3 创建一个绑定网络口的配置文件/etc/sysconfig/network-scripts/ifcfg-bond0,内容如下:

DEVICE=bond0                  #虚拟网卡名称

BOOTPROTO=static

IPADDR=192.168.254.38         #IP地址

NETMASK=255.255.255.0         #子网掩码

GATEWAY=192.168.254.254       #网关

BORADCAST=192.168.254.255     #广播地址

ONBOOT=yes

TYPE=Ethernet

2.4 修改/etc/modprobe.conf,配置绑定模型,加入以下内容:

alias bond0 bonding

options bond0 miimon=100 mode=1

#选项 miilmon 是指定隔多长时间来进行链路监测,单位是ms。

#选项 mode 是表示绑定口的工作模式,有0-7共7种模式,常用的有0和1模式,mode=0表示"round-robin"策略,两张卡同时工作在负载均衡状态。mode=1表示"active-backup"策略,两张卡一用一备的备份状态。

2.5 修改的是/etc/rc.local,负责在系统启动时将虚拟网卡与两张物理网卡相绑定,增加以下内容:

ifenslave bond0 eth0 eth1

route add -net 192.168.254.255 netmask 255.255.255.0 bond0 ####################################

通过查看bond0的工作状态查询能详细的掌握bonding的工作状态

[root@rhas-13 bonding]# cat /proc/net/bonding/bond0

以上配置完成后,重启系统就可以了

Linux四网口绑定,linux 网口绑定相关推荐

  1. linux四种文件系统,Linux环境下常用的四种文件系统

    Linux环境下几种常用的文件系统 1.ext2 ext2是为解决ext文件系统的缺陷而设计的可扩展的.高性能的文件系统,又被称为二级扩展文件系统.它是Linux文件系统中使用最多的类型,并且在速度和 ...

  2. linux内核端口绑定,linux 多网卡bonding 绑定 端口聚合

    将多个Linux网络端口绑定为一个,可以提升网络的性能,比如对于备份服务器,需要在一个晚上备份几个T的数据, 如果使用单个的千兆网口将会是很严重的瓶颈.其它的应用,比如ftp服务器,高负载的下载网站, ...

  3. linux网卡汇聚模式,Linux网卡聚合 linux多网卡绑定聚合之bond模式原理

    Linux网卡聚合 linux多网卡绑定聚合之bond模式原理 发布时间:2014-10-14 09:44:35   作者:佚名   我要评论 将多个Linux网络端口绑定为一个,可以提升网络的性能, ...

  4. linux下双网卡绑定,Linux下双网卡绑定bond0

    一:原理: linux操作系统下双网卡绑定有七种模式.现在一般的企业都会使用双网卡接入,这样既能添加网络带宽,同时又能做相应的冗余,可以说是好处多多.而一般企业都会使用linux操作系统下自带的网卡绑 ...

  5. oracle 连接 双网卡,Oracle Linux 6.4(BOND)双网卡绑定实战—附加说明

    Oracle Linux 6.4(BOND)双网卡绑定实战mdash;附加说明 操作环境 Oracle Linux Server release 6.4 内核 Linux rac1 2.6.39-40 ...

  6. zynq linux ip配置,ZYNQ+linux网口调试笔记(2)PS-GEM1

    1. 开发环境 Windows SDK 2017.4 Ubuntu Petalinux 2017.4 硬件平台:米联客ZYNQ开发板MIZ7035 2. 开发目标 在ZYNQ上使用gigE Visio ...

  7. linux网卡顺序问题,linux网卡绑定及网卡顺序变更测试.docx

    Linux网卡顺序变更导致网卡绑定出错及解决办法测试 2012/2/21 描述:linux中新安装网卡会导致原网卡识别顺序紊乱,影响网络及网卡绑定正常工作,此时可以更改/etc/sysconfig/n ...

  8. Linux系统利用C语言获取网口信息(IP地址,MAC地址,状态,带宽speed等)

    目录 设计思路 ioctl操作参数 获取网口的遍历结构 获取对应的参数信息 源代码 ifinfo.c ifinfo.h test.c 测试结果 设计思路 首先给需要查询的信息定义个结构(当然,这里可以 ...

  9. Linux平台下裸设备的绑定:

    Linux平台下裸设备的绑定: 运用RAW绑定 方法一 raw的配置(1) [root@qs-dmm-rh2 mapper]# cat /etc/rc.local #!/bin/sh # # This ...

  10. Linux下通过NetLink获取网口信息

    原本是打算通过ioctl这个api获取网口是否插线状态,结果设备网口和驱动适配有问题 查出来的结果跟实际网口对不上 即使用ifconfig也是对不上 (ifconfig也是用的ioctl) 然后发现e ...

最新文章

  1. 极光推送(不定期更新)
  2. SAP Fiori Elements 公开课第一单元概要介绍
  3. 关于SimpleDateFormat时间格式化线程安全问题
  4. C语言(CED)最长公共子序列----动态规划第一题
  5. python如何创建一个列表_使用python中的format()创建一个列表(make a list using format() in python)...
  6. 项目:文本相似度分析(C++)
  7. 绝缘检测是什么? 绝缘检测原理 绝缘检测检测的是什么?那个量?电压?电流?电阻?
  8. java 解析证书_Java x509证书解析类
  9. https配置CA证书安装教程
  10. ip漂移技术_您的项目是否遭受技术漂移的困扰?
  11. Git Github操作简易教程
  12. Mongodb副本集RECOVERING
  13. 内网渗透总结二:第二步管理员密码的明文和hash获取
  14. HTML 的js中手机号,身份证号等正则表达式表示
  15. 美国第三季度GDP超预期增长2.6%,铁矿石期货跌4%创新低,欧洲央行加息75个基点
  16. JS每晚24:00更新某方法
  17. 2022年3000元电脑最强组装 组装电脑配置推荐3000元左右
  18. 计算机键盘怎么换键,电脑修改键盘按键的方法
  19. 如何创建批处理文件?
  20. 什么是大数据(Big Data)?

热门文章

  1. 【物理应用】大气湍流相位屏仿真matlab源码
  2. 2017新媒体运营升职加薪指南:从内容到数据,如何走好新媒体的进阶之路?
  3. 富力等待黎明:李思廉走在还债的漫漫长路
  4. linux文件赋予用户权限,Linux 给用户赋予操作权限
  5. (zz)计算复杂性:NP=P?
  6. user_agreement
  7. 学计算机要学数学么,学计算机数学要求高吗 数学不好怎么办?
  8. 如何安装Tomcat
  9. 英语作文计算机国际会议开幕词,学术会议发言稿 英文(精选多篇)
  10. 80%的人分不清传感网与物联网的区别,这二者之间的具体区别到底是什么?